Extinction
In behavioral psychology, the process whereby a learned response is reduced or eliminated, often as a result of repeated absence of the expected reinforcement.
Conditioned Stimulus
A previously neutral stimulus that, after being associated with an unconditioned stimulus, elicits a conditioned response.
Classically Conditioned
Pertains to a learning process in psychology where an association is made between a naturally occurring stimulus and a previously neutral stimulus.
